PACIFIC WESTERN BREWING ... HISTORY IN THE MAKING
The New Year 2017 marked a milestone in Prince George, the 60th anniversary of commercial brewing in the hub city of the BC Interior. Canada’s longest running, British Columbian-owned brewery was established in 1957 on a fresh water spring in Prince George. Originally named Caribou Brewing, Pacific Western Brewing Company (PWB) has had seven owners over its storied past and achieved many milestones: including being the first Canadian brewer to export to mainland China in 1991 and then to Russia in 1996. Along the way these achievements have shaped the character and quality of BC-owned brewing for six decades.
